VIDEO: Ten-year-old Kishon John Celebrates End of Cancer Treatment in Colombia

21 August 2025 - 15:37

Ten-year-old Kishon John has triumphantly marked the end of his chemotherapy treatment at a medical facility in Colombia, ringing the symbolic bell that signifies the conclusion of his battle with Hodgkin Lymphoma.

With tears of joy streaming down his face, Kishon celebrated the milestone surrounded by medical staff who supported him throughout his journey. The young patient also expressed heartfelt gratitude to the healthcare professionals who guided him through his treatment.

Kishon had traveled to Colombia after being diagnosed with Hodgkin Lymphoma several years ago. His treatment was made possible thanks to funding from Antigua and Barbuda’s Medical Benefits Scheme, the Calvin Ayre Foundation, and support from local communities.

Speaking on behalf of the family, relatives expressed deep appreciation for the generosity and assistance that enabled Kishon to receive life-saving care abroad. The family emphasized that the support of both local and international partners played a pivotal role in this moment of triumph.

Kishon’s celebration not only marks the end of a challenging treatment but also stands as a testament to the resilience of young patients and the importance of community and global support in the fight against cancer.
